Decibel Open Air & Decibel Easter Festival

Florence kicks off the festival season early with Decibel Easter Festival, delivering an intense two-day electronic music experience that will keep you dancing non-stop. The festival brings together the best of both worlds, catering to hard techno lovers and house music fans, with each genre having its own dedicated day. Headliners include the legendary Fatboy Slim and the hard-hitting I Hate Models,alongside Fantasm, Luca Agnelli, and more, ensuring an unforgettable Easter weekend.
But the madness doesn’t stop there— as Decibel Open Air returns this September for a massive season finale. Held in Cascine Park, just steps from central Florence, it’s the perfect mix of top quality electronic music, lush green space, and the city’s iconic energy. With the lineup still to be revealed, one thing’s certain: the experience will be worth living.
When? Sun-Mon, April 20th-21st / Sat-Sun, September 6th-7th
Where? Nelson Mandela Forum, Florence / Parco Delle Cascine
Who’s playing? Fatboy Slim, I Hate Models, Fantasm, Luca Agnelli & more.
Superaurora Festival

Superaurora Festival is a multi-sensory experience held in an iconic Italian castle, featuring four stages and over 35 artists, including clubbing icons Carl Cox and Nic Fanciulli. Expect an eclectic lineup with international DJs, live performances, and stunning visuals landing in the outskirts of Roma. Nestled near the sea and surrounded by greenery, this festival offers the ultimate fusion of music, culture, and nature.
When? Fri-Sun, June 20th-22nd
Where? Parco di Castello Chigi, Rome
Who’s playing? Carl Cox, Kid Yugi, Nic Fanciulli, MACE, Anna Tur & more.

Komorebi Festival

Deep in the Italian Alps, Komorebi Music Festival offers a unique and intimate experience inside the historic Forte di Vinadio. This festival blends the raw power of nature with immersive soundscapes, creating an atmosphere of serenity and connection. The lineup includes Circle of Live, Sebastian Mullaert, and Efdemin, promising a musical journey you won’t forget.
When? Fri-Sun, September 5th-7th
Where? Forte di Vinadio, Vinadio
Who’s playing? Circle Of Live, Sebastian Mullaert, Daniel, Feral, Polygonia, Efdemin & more.
Limbo ‘RISE’ Festival

Limbo ‘RISE’ Festival offers an immersive 4-day experience set against the stunning backdrop of Tuscany. The festival combines electronic music, art, and mindfulness in a boutique setting, offering a mix of intimate performances and larger-than-life moments. Whether you’re camping in luxury or staying in cozy chalets, this festival invites you to unwind and enjoy a weekend of open-air clubbing, nature, and community.
When? Thur-Sun, July 10th-13th
Where? Il Ciocco, Tuscany
Who’s playing? Acid Pauli, Osunlade, Luca Bacchetti, & more.
